King Abdulaziz International Airport called on travelers for Umrah and charter flights to come early, to ensure that travel procedures are completed on time.
And the airport management demanded, via Twitter, the need to come before the flight time, no less than four hours and no more than six hours, with a valid travel ticket for their next destination, and the completion of the legal documents necessary for travel.
This comes in the interest of the King Abdulaziz Airport Administration to ensure the speedy completion of passenger procedures, given the intensity of the operational traffic witnessed by the airport with the continued return of Umrah pilgrims to their countries.
